In children with T1DM already achieving target HbA1c levels, those with HbA1c <48 mmol/mol have no increase in hypoglycaemia.

Rozario Kavitha , Edge Julie

Introduction: There is concern that lowering the HbA1c target for children and young people with T1DM would increase the amount and severity of hypoglycaemia.Aims: To examine the relationship between HbA1c and blood glucose (BG) levels, particularly hypoglycaemia, in children with T1DM treated to current target.Methods: BG meter downloads (Diasend) were examined for the 3 months before the latest HbA1c level in children with HbA1c ...

A case of a rare adrenocortical tumour mimicking neuroblastoma

Rozario Kavitha , Ryan Fiona , Makaya Taffy

Presentation and investigation: A 10-month-old girl presented with a bluish lump on the left side of her abdomen which was increasing in size. An abdominal mass was palpable on examination. An ultrasound showed a large, partly calcified mass measuring 9×6×9 cm arising from the left adrenal gland. There were also calcified lesions in her liver and lungs suggesting metastsis. MRI confirmed the ultrasound finding plus detected an intraspinal deposit with some cord compr...

Positive thyroid peroxidase antibodies at diagnosis of type 1 diabetes mellitus is associated with earlier onset of thyroid disorders

Rozario Kavitha , Hlaing Su Su , Makaya Taffy

Aims: To assess the relationship between thyroid peroxidase (TPO) antibodies and the development of thyroid disorders in children with type 1 diabetes mellitus (T1DM).Method: TPO antibody status and duration of diabetes at diagnosis of thyroid disorder were cross-sectionally examined in all children attending the Oxford T1DM service (n=342, male:female ratio 1:0.8).Results: Twenty patients were identified with thyroid como...
